Transaction 95450ea05b589cfe94786a6f74510a7c5a072debfe02ebffda237b02026ba531

2 Input
2 Outputs
  • 95450ea05b589cfe94786a6f74510a7c5a072debfe02ebffda237b02026ba531:0
  • value  137549
    address  1Fp3nY24QTkrf4VCA4GqVYza22cWChj4WL
  • 95450ea05b589cfe94786a6f74510a7c5a072debfe02ebffda237b02026ba531:1
  • value  2838500
    address  1Hcz3PDsg6aQFwteCUiC9cuYn3D3ZS5gRL